Transaction 296c8619ef579539b94282faea5cba3c3ae2b3dbe0bedb68d4b81f219c10ca5c
1 Input
1 Output
-
296c8619ef579539b94282faea5cba3c3ae2b3dbe0bedb68d4b81f219c10ca5c:0
- value
- 8957690
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c1cf84e57e19e9f175cc1d75a3bc71df253f94a
- address
- bc1qhsw0snjhux0f796uc8t45w78rhe98722ymsh76